Free Baby Boxes and Welcome Kits
One of the most valuable free resources for expecting mothers is the free baby box. These boxes typically include a mix of full-size products and samples, such as diapers, wipes, baby clothing, and other essentials. The following are examples of free baby boxes available through various platforms.
Babylist Hello Baby Box
Babylist, a popular baby registry platform, offers a free Hello Baby Box to all users who create a registry. This box is valued at approximately $300 and includes full-size baby products like diapers, wipes, baby clothes, bottles, pacifiers, and a variety of samples and coupons. The box is designed to provide a useful start for new parents without upfront costs.
Amazon Baby Box
Amazon also offers a free baby box to users who create an Amazon baby registry. The box is valued at $35 and typically includes a baby blanket, full-size Huggies wipes, an Avent baby bottle, and various baby samples. This is described as one of the most valuable free pregnancy resources by some users.
Additional Baby Box Providers
Other platforms like Walmart, Noobie, Target, and Baby Box Company also offer free baby boxes or welcome kits for new or expecting mothers. These boxes often include a curated selection of baby essentials and are available as part of registry or promotional programs.

Insurance-Covered Baby Essentials
One of the most underutilized resources for expecting mothers is the insurance coverage for essential baby products and services. These programs are often fully or partially free, provided the mother has a qualifying insurance plan.
Free Breast Pumps
Under the Affordable Care Act (ACA), most insurance plans cover breast pumps and nursing supplies as part of preventive care. This means that eligible mothers can obtain a free breast pump through their insurance provider without additional costs. Some insurance plans also provide hand-free breast pumps as part of these benefits.
Maternity and Postpartum Support Gear
Several maternity and postpartum support products are also covered by insurance plans. These include:
- Maternity support bands to reduce pregnancy-related discomfort.
- Compression socks to alleviate leg swelling and improve circulation.
- Postpartum girdles or recovery garments to support the abdomen after childbirth.
Insurance companies like Aeroflow offer these items at no cost to the mother, handling the approval and delivery process.
